'Retailer/supplier partnership of the year' 2004
Retail technology specialists, Retail Assist and Grantfort Computer Systems (GCS), providers of the Merret Supply Chain Solution, announce that their partnership with Rubicon Retail has been selected by the European Retail Solutions Awards panel as the winning Retailer/Supplier Partnership of the Year.
The judging panel expressed itself as impressed with the way that the partnership worked to implement the outsourcing of the Rubicon supply chain and IT development and support. This had to be undertaken during the critical selling season and to a tight timeline.
The purpose of this award category is to recognise the strongest business relationship between a retailer and its supplier(s), where a dynamic partnership brought about accountability and flexibility. "This partnership is delivering clear business benefits," was the panel's reaction to the Retail Assist/Grantfort Computer Systems/Rubicon submission.
Retail Assist and Grantfort Computer Systems have worked together for 5 years to deliver IT solutions and support, working with clients such as Adams Childrenswear and Burberry. This close association between the two companies gave Rubicon Retail the confidence to move forward with them, based upon the knowledge that both companies had a wealth of Retail IT experience and the ability to deliver a complete IT solution.
The partnership's award application was built upon work carried out over the past 12 months to effect the transition of Rubicon Retail's systems from its former owner, Arcadia, to new outsourced suppliers for Accounting services, Payroll and HR Administration, Logistics, Telecoms, IT Services and Supply Chain solutions, and to give it control of its systems and services. Rubicon Retail owns the Warehouse and Principles fashion brands which have a national and international presence.

The systems and solutions transition that Rubicon Retail undertook with Retail Assist and Grantfort Computer Systems was achieved within an aggressive 6-month timescale, including commencing implementation over the Christmas period. It involved a transition team of some 100 people and brought about rapid business change affecting 4,000 Rubicon employees.
New system solutions were developed/implemented for Merchandising, Warehousing, Payroll, HR and Finance, in addition to a new Store Concession solution. Wide-reaching infrastructure changes were also effected, including a new Distribution Centre, Financial Accounting Centre, Systems Data Centre and Broadband Retail Network.
